All You Need To Know About World's Largest Airport Being Built In Dubai
New Delhi, April 29 -- Dubai has started construction on a new terminal at Al Maktoum International Airport, aiming to make it the world's largest. All operations at Dubai International Airport will eventually be shifted to Al Maktoum International Airport in the upcoming years, as announced by the emirate's ruler. UAE PM HH Sheikh Mohammad announced the news on X on Sunday, saying, "Today, we approved the designs for the new passenger terminals at Al Maktoum International Airport, and commencing construction of the building at a cost of AED 128 billion as part of Dubai Aviation Corporation's strategy."
